> > Thanks for the review! Yes, generated-configure.sh changes are due to
> > version skew of autoconf being used. I'll try to generate configure on
> > an older machine so as to avoid this before pushing. Does that sound
> > ok?
>
> THe runstatedir changes come and go (even in the jdk8u-dev history),
> depending on whether Debian's autoconf is used, which patches its
> autoconf 2.69 build to handle runstatedir. There hasn't been an
> autoconf upstream release in many, many years, so going back to older
> versions will not solve this. If you want to avoid this change, you
> either have to use Debian's autoconf, or back it out manually.
